Clip system for use with tarps and other flexible sheet material
First Claim
1. A clip system for use with flexible sheet material, said clip system comprising:
- a clip body comprising;
first and second jaw members at a first end of said clip body;
a live hinge that joins said first and second jaw members at a base end of said body;
means for adjusting a gap between said jaw members so as to selectively grip and release said sheet material therein, said means for adjusting said gap between said first and second jaw members comprising;
a finger-operated screw adjustment mechanism comprising a screw member having a threaded shaft section in engagement with at least one of said jaw members, said screw member spanning said jaw members at a location intermediate distal ends of said jaw members and said live hinge at said base end of said body;
said first and second jaw members being angled together distally so that in response to tightening of said screw member said jaw members first come into contact at distal tips thereof, and being formed of resiliently flexible material so that in response to continued tightening of said screw member after first coming into contact at said distal tips said angled jaw members collapse resiliently so as to flatten out into a substantially parallel orientation against one another; and
a first coupling portion at a second, generally opposite end of said clip body; and
at least one attachment fitting comprising;
a second coupling portion at a first, generally opposite end of said attachment fitting; and
an attachment portion at a second, generally opposite end of said attachment fitting for engaging an article separate from said sheet material;
said first and second coupling portions rotatingly mounting said attachment fitting to said clip body so that said attachment fitting and clip body are free to twist independently of one another about an axis of rotation aligned generally from said first end of said clip body to said second end of said attachment fitting.

Abstract
A clip system for use with tarps and other flexible sheet material. The system includes first and second parts that are rotatably mounted so as to be free to twist independently of one another, in response to wind or other forces. The first part may be a clip body having jaws for gripping a tarp or other flexible sheet material, and the second part may be an attachment fitting for engaging an article separate from the tarp. There may be a series of different attachment fittings that are interchangeably mountable to the clip body, such as a hook, a screw-on fitting for attachment to a bottle that forms a weight, or a fitting for attachment of a strap or shock cord, for example. The two pieces may be joined by a male coupler and a female receptacle that receives the coupler in locking engagement. The male coupler may have a plurality of resiliently flexible legs with beveled end surfaces that flex inwardly to pass through the opening of the female receptacle. The legs then snap back outwardly so that undercut surfaces on the ends of the legs engage the receptacle to prevent separation of the pieces. The coupler and receptacle may further include cooperating annular surfaces that form a bearing interface for rotation of the parts.
